The beaches around Yangyang County — particularly Jukdo Beach and Surfyy Beach — have established the most developed surfing culture in Korea over the past decade, with consistent swell from the East Sea making the area viable for learners and intermediate surfers. Surf schools and board rental operations are well-established; the scene has attracted a community of Korean surfers and a small international presence. The off-season months of April, May, and October provide the best combination of swell, cooler water, and manageable crowds. The surrounding Yangyang area has developed a cafe and restaurant strip oriented toward the surf visitor that is more developed than the beach towns to the north and south.
